Abstract

Electrical Engineering
Seven Level Inverter, MPPT Controller, Incremental Conductance algorithm, Simulink.
Non conventional energy source is a need of today’s world. This paper presents proposed method of solar power generation system. To take this system up to next level in proposed system seven level inverter is added. The combined advantage of solar power generation system with seven level inverter systems has edge over other power generation system in terms of several quality parameters. The proposed system has been implemented using system modelling. For system modelling Matlab Simulink is used. Seven level inverter with all added advantages of multilevel inverter like Low electromagnetic interference, low disturbances, and working at low switching frequency makes this system outstanding with respect to other power generation systems. Solar power generation system is equipped with MPPT Controller to track maximum power for solar panel system. MPPT ensures maximum power at changing environment. In MPPT Controller Incremental conductance algorithm is implemented to ensure maximum peak power tracking.
